Nancy Ward

 

Nancy Ward (1738--1822),

A mixed-blood Cherokee womanwho lived during the eighteenth century, was the Cherokee nation's last "Beloved Woman." At a time that the Cherokee nation was frequently at battle with American troops and white settlers who had occupied their traditional lands, Ward made repeated attempts to establish peace between the various parties....READ MORE
